Depression Therapy: Is It Ever Too Late To Treat Depression?

Depression therapy can help at many stages of life, even after years of low mood, poor sleep, or loss of interest. In psychiatric care, treatment timing matters less than getting an accurate diagnosis and a workable plan. Many patients with long-standing symptoms also meet criteria for treatment-resistant depression, which means earlier approaches did not bring enough relief. A psychiatrist can reassess what happened before and identify options that fit current needs.

Why it is not “too late”

While depression changes thinking, energy, and behavior patterns, those patterns can shift with structured care. Depression therapy works best when it targets both biology and daily functioning, not only sadness. Even when symptoms feel familiar, the drivers may change over time, including chronic stress, grief, medical illness, or medication effects. A psychiatrist also evaluates bipolar disorder, PTSD, substance use, and attention disorders, because these conditions can look like depression and respond to different treatments. When the diagnosis fits and the plan matches severity, depression therapy can still move symptoms in a healthier direction.

Rechecking the basics in complex cases

A careful review often uncovers reasons why prior care did not provide sufficient relief. A psychiatrist confirms whether past medication trials reached a therapeutic dose, lasted long enough, and were used consistently. The evaluation also covers sleep apnea, thyroid disease, anemia, vitamin B12 deficiency, chronic pain, and hormonal changes, which can worsen mood and blunt treatment response. In treatment-resistant depression, clinicians also look at agitation, anxiety, and irritability, because these symptoms can require different medication strategies.

Depression therapy also benefits from tracking measurable targets, such as sleep duration, appetite, work attendance, and social activity, rather than relying on mood alone. Many patients find it useful to bring a brief treatment history to the visit, including:

  • Medication names, doses, and trial length
  • Side effects that led to stopping or reducing
  • Therapy type and session frequency
  • Hospitalizations, intensive programs, or crisis visits

This information helps the psychiatrist develop a practical path forward and reduces the need for repeat trials. It also supports shared decision-making and clearer follow-up.

What next-step treatment can include

For persistent symptoms, depression therapy may involve a combination plan. A psychiatrist may adjust the antidepressant class, add an augmentation medication, or address sleep directly to improve daytime function. Evidence-based psychotherapy, such as cognitive behavioral therapy or interpersonal therapy, can strengthen coping skills, reduce avoidance, and improve problem-solving. For treatment-resistant depression, some patients may qualify for neuromodulation options, such as transcranial magnetic stimulation, or for medication-based approaches delivered in specialized settings, depending on history and risk factors. A psychiatrist also builds a safety plan when suicidal thoughts appear, including crisis contacts and clear steps for urgent evaluation.

Building progress over time

Depression therapy works best with steady follow-up and honest feedback about side effects, adherence, and daily stressors. A psychiatrist can also coordinate care with primary care, pain management, or sleep medicine when medical issues amplify symptoms.
